When is the best time to book my B&B in Coombe Keynes?
When you’re planning your trip to Coombe Keynes, be sure to take into account the year-round temperatures. The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 61°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 45°F. Average annual precipitation for Coombe Keynes is 31 inches.

How can I get to and around Coombe Keynes?
You can map out your trip in and around Coombe Keynes ahead of time with these transportation options. Fly into Bournemouth (BOH-Bournemouth Intl.), which is located 19 mi (30.6 km) from the city center. If you’d like to explore around the area, you may want a rental car for your journey.
